实践

前端监控与 RUM 数据采集最佳实践

概述真实用户监控(RUM)通过在生产环境采集关键体验指标与错误事件,为性能与稳定性提供数据闭环。本文聚焦采集、采样与数据质量保障。已验证技术参数以 75th 百分位作为性能目标评估标准,反映大多数用户体验推荐使用 `PerformanceObserver` 采集 LCP/CLS/INP、资源与长任务

前端性能优化与可观察性实践(2025)

前端性能优化与可观察性实践(2025)前端性能直接影响转化与留存。本文从构建优化、运行时优化与可观察性三个维度给出实践建议。一、构建优化代码分割与懒加载:以路由/组件为颗粒度拆分,减少首屏负载。资源优化:使用现代图片格式与按需字体;开启压缩与缓存控制。依赖治理:移除未使用依赖与重复 polyfill

WebAssembly多媒体处理架构与性能优化实践

WebAssembly多媒体处理架构与性能优化实践1. 核心技术原理与架构设计WebAssembly (Wasm) 为多媒体处理带来了接近原生的性能表现,通过将C/C++编写的多媒体处理库编译为WebAssembly模块,在浏览器环境中实现高效的多媒体数据处理。核心架构基于Emscripten工具链

React Server Components数据获取架构与性能优化实践

React Server Components数据获取架构与性能优化实践1. 核心技术原理与架构设计React Server Components (RSC) 引入了革命性的服务端组件架构,通过将组件渲染过程移至服务端,显著减少了客户端JavaScript包体积并提升了首屏加载性能。RSC的核心架构